VehicleLeyland National 1151/2R/0401
B48F Leyland National Mk.I
New with B46D layout, single-door conversion (5/80) to B49F layout . Reseated (by 11/81) to B48F layout
Number185 (OCN 225L)
New to Northern General Transport Co. Ltd. as fleet number 125L
OperatorMidland Red (West) Limited, Digbeth depot
New (7/73) to Northern General Transport Co. Ltd., Gateshead. Passed (4/84) to Midland Red (West) Ltd., Worcester. Withdrawn (12/89). Passed (3/90) to North (dealer), Leeds
LocationStreetly Road, Short Heath.
DescriptionFreshly repainted for the new Birmingham and Black Country services.
Seen on the first day of operations, when Midland Red (West) Limited reopened Digbeth depot for Deregularion Day. Birmingham Local Service 65 operated on Sundays only between Birmingham and Short Heath.
DateSunday 26th October 1986
